Search jobs > Montreal-Est, QC > Senior developer

Senior Integration Developer

American Iron and Metal
Montréal-Est, Québec, Canada
Full-time

Job Description

The Senior Integrator Developer will identify, plan, and execute on integration strategies across various platforms.

  • Working with system design specifications, develops detailed specifications for software programming
  • Develop and maintain advanced database systems including data warehouses, data marts, and models needed for business.
  • Develop data integration between various source / target systems comprising of flat files, webservices, REST and SOAP based API’s JSON.
  • Review ETL performance and conduct performance tuning as required on mappings / workflows or SQL.
  • Identify opportunities, recommend, and implement solutions to improve data availability, optimize data retention, and enhance data security.
  • Provide technical leadership in developing and contributing to strategy, architecture, and design for integration projects
  • Provides technical guidance to data integration engineers
  • Deep knowledge of enterprise application architecture
  • Creates documentation to support architecture processes and designs
  • Automate tasks through appropriate tools and scripting
  • Collaborate on various activities related to projects within the framework of Agile and DevOps cultures
  • Review code and architecture to ensure compliance with company development standards and industry best practices
  • Involved in the maintenance and enhancement of existing operational integration systems

Qualifications

  • BSc in Computer Science or related degree
  • 5+ years of Data Engineering experience
  • Good understanding of Web Services protocols such as REST and API design for extensibility and portability
  • Experience with Scrum / Agile development methodologies
  • Strong Experience with Data Warehousing, API management service
  • Strong knowledge of JavaScript, REST API, Python, and SQL and query optimizations
  • Experience with D365 ERP or similar including integration experience
  • Experience in Azure Integration solutions, Data Factory, Logic Apps, Functions, and SSIS
  • Experience in leadership or mentoring junior data engineers
  • Azure Data Engineer Associate certification an asset
  • Good communication and time management skills

Additional Information

What we offer!

  • Competitive salary + other perks
  • Group insurance & RRSP program
  • Company-wide events throughout the year (BBQ, Holiday party etc.)
  • Free gym on site
  • Two cafeterias on site (subsidized meal program available)
  • Dynamic & rewarding work environment- work on high-impact, meaningful projects while also having fun!
  • 1 day ago
Related jobs
Vention
Montreal, Quebec

Install, configure, deploy and commission Vention’s turnkey projects at the client site, focusing on hardware integration and software integration. ...

Epic Games
Montreal, Quebec

The ideal candidate is a senior AI/ML developer with experience in real-time applications and customer-focused. Our team of programming experts are always innovating to improve the tools and technology that empower content developers worldwide. Ability to interact with different developers in a geog...

KPMG
Canada, Canada

Building on the success of our practice, we are seeking talented and energetic candidates to join our Advisory team as a Senior Consultant working in our Management Consulting, Enterprise Solutions, Oracle practice. Previous experience in integrations for Oracle Cloud ERP. Act as a trusted advisor t...

American Iron and Metal
Montréal-Est, Quebec

The Senior Integrator Developer will identify, plan, and execute on integration strategies across various platforms. Develop data integration between various source/target systems comprising of flat files, webservices, REST and SOAP based API’s JSON. Provide technical leadership in developing and co...

Delmar International
Montreal, Quebec

Reporting to the Integration Manager, the Senior Integration Developer will be responsible for analysing, developing, deploying and supporting data integration solutions across multiple environments. Working with their manager and other members of the integration team, the incumbent will also be res...

Promoted
Intellex Systems Group
Canada

Full Stack Developer (2)– our client requires two (2) Full stack Developers to help with the development of technical solutions, including the design, development, testing and deployment of code and more. ...

Promoted
Produits forestiers Résolu
Montreal, Quebec

The position of Analyst, Master Data Management is part of a centralized group, which aims to manage all master data databases including customers and pricing. Analyst, Master Data Management (Temporary). Ensure the entry and maintenance of the customer and pricing files in SAP, more specifically: c...

Promoted
Pratt & Whitney Canada
Longueuil, Quebec

Microsoft Dynamics CRM Senior Developer Lead. Développeur Senior Microsoft Dynamics CRM. As developer, you will be highly involved in the designs, configuration, deployments, and supports of the enterprise MS Dynamics CRM. As Team Lead, you will supervise a team of offshore developers. ...

Promoted
National Bank
Montreal, Quebec

A career as a Data Engineering Analyst in the Digital Customer Experience Data Rotation Program means working closely with the Bank's sectors and business areas, as well as those working in analytics. This job allows you to have a positive impact on our organization by putting data learning at the h...

Mindlance
Montreal, Quebec

Experienced and proven track record in developing and mentoring developers working on a full stack java environment, preferably in the communication surveillance field. Experience with JAVA, JEE, JavaScript, Perl. Strong grasp & working experience in Java, Python, VueJS (or similar) with a proven tr...